Relation between Zitterbewegung and the charge conductivity, Berry curvature and the Chern number of multi band systems
Abstract
We show that the charge conductivity for impurity free multi band electronic systems can be expressed in terms of the diagonal and non-diagonal elements of the Zitterbewegung amplitudes while the Berry curvature and the Chern number is related only to the diagonal elements. Thus, the phenomenon of the Zitterbewegung can no longer be viewed just as an interesting consequence of quantum physics but it has also an experimental relevance. Moreover, through several examples we demonstrate how efficient our approach is in the analytical calculation of the charge conductivity.
